California Group Launches Campaign Against Illegal Immigration

[EFE News Service - 1/17/02] Santa Ana - The California Coalition for Immigration Reform launched a state-wide campaign against illegal immigration, hoping post-Sept. 11 concerns will renew interest in its initiative.

Coalition president Barbara Coe told the press Tuesday that the new measure, known as the "Homeland Security Initiative," is aimed at stripping illegal immigrants' access to public services.

The group's initiative, a modified version of Proposition 187, proposes amending the California Constitution. Coe helped pass Proposition 187 in 1994, but the proposal was later suspended by the courts as unconstitutional and eliminated by Gov. Grey Davis.

The new measure would force public officials to check the legal status of everyone applying for social benefits. Under the proposal, all illegal immigrants who apply for public benefits would be arrested on the spot and transferred to the custody of the Immigration and Naturalization Service (INS).

Coe told the Orange County Register she is collecting signatures to put the Homeland Security Initiative to a vote in the next state elections. The difference between Proposition 187 and the Homeland Security Initiative is that the latter was reviewed by five attorneys, including two specialists in constitutional law, Coe noted.

Harold Martin, a member of the California Coalition for Immigration Reform, told the daily that Mexican immigrants want "to overthrow our culture, our way of life." "Their objectives are no different than Osama bin Laden's," Martin said.
